Description

2,3-Dihydroxybenzaldehyde 2-Benzothiazolyl Hydrazone is a specialized organic compound belonging to the class of hydrazone derivatives. This compound is valued for its role as a key intermediate and analytical reagent, particularly in the development of sensors and coordination chemistry. It is primarily utilized by research institutions and industrial R&D departments focused on materials science, analytical chemistry, and the synthesis of novel chelating agents.

Application

  • Analytical Reagent: Used as a selective chromogenic agent or chelating ligand for the spectrophotometric detection and quantification of specific metal ions in analytical chemistry.
  • Chemical Sensor Development: Serves as a critical component in the design of optical or electrochemical sensors due to its specific binding properties.
  • Coordination Chemistry: Acts as a versatile ligand for the synthesis of novel metal complexes with potential catalytic or magnetic properties.
  • Pharmaceutical Intermediate: Employed in research-scale synthesis for the development of new pharmacologically active molecules containing the benzothiazole moiety.
  • Materials Science Research: Investigated for its potential in creating functional materials, such as non-linear optical (NLO) materials or organic semiconductors.

Basic Information

Product Name 2,3-Dihydroxybenzaldehyde 2-Benzothiazolyl Hydrazone
CAS No. 87524-54-7
Molecular Formula C₁₄H₁₁N₃O₂S
Molecular Weight 285.32 g/mol
Synonyms 2,3-Dihydroxybenzaldehyde 2-benzothiazolylhydrazone; 2-Benzothiazolylhydrazone of 2,3-dihydroxybenzaldehyde; (E)-2-(2-(Benzo[d]thiazol-2-yl)hydrazono)methyl)benzene-1,2-diol; 2,3-DHBTH; BTH-DHB

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). This compound is light-sensitive and should be handled accordingly to maintain stability.
